I think there is the possibility this is happening for every package that has pre-compilation enabled. If this is happening, it is possible that the problem is some bug in the julia code that deals with the path to the precompiled file, it can be happening because there is some bug that only happens with Windows+“path with asian characters”+“julia package precompilation”. I am guessing that because:

  1. It has to be something considerably specific, otherwise other people in the forum would have the same problem.
  2. It has to be related to something in your system that is not just the Julia compiler, otherwise resetting Julia installation from scratch would solve it.

If you look to the error message, it seems that it parses the path correctly in some cases (like in the line starting with “Status” in your last post) but in other cases (like the line starting with “Cannot open cache file” in your last post) it seems to disappear with the backslash (\) before the “.julia”. It may be a problem in my end, but I am not sure of it.

Did you try to execute the Julia REPL passing the flag julia --compiled-modules=no?
